Review of Far from Heaven (2002) by Ken Fox for TV Guide Magazine — 28 Feb 2005
Haynes took an enormous risk here, but thanks to his thoughtful script and an utterly sincere performance from Moore, what could have easily become a cold, calculated exercise in postmodern pastiche winds up a powerful and deeply moving example of melodramatic moviemaking.
